CVE-2002-2295

CVE-2002-2295 affects Pico Server (pServ) 2.0 beta 1–beta 5. The issue is a buffer overflow in the HTTP handling path, triggered by: (1) a 1024-byte TCP stream message (off-by-one overflow), (2) long method name, (3) long version number, (4) long User-Agent header, or (5) long file path. CVE-2005-1952

CVE-2005-1952 affects Pico Server (pServ) 3.3. A directory traversal flaw all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files and, via a crafted URL containing /./ before each .. sequence, potentially execute arbitrary commands due to an incorrect directory depth count.
